2008-04-20 15:58:49 In reply to LEBATO (2008-04-19 18:58:34) Posted by LEBATO Well I don't know. I doubt it though. Do you still have to shoot someone like a million times on the PC version? Weapons are pretty boring all around. But yeah I should give the PC version a try. It also felt like the maps were too big, and all of them looked alike. Using that as your basis for it being a bad game is a bit strange. The game plays that way for a reason. It's not like Valve just somehow messed up the development of TF2. It is, after all, one of the most balanced shooters that I've played while also being an absolutely beautiful game. Even though the game is a shooter at heart it still requires a large amount of strategy as appose to sheer skill in aiming. Knowing how to use a certain class effectively is extremely important and can mean the difference in beating a heavy or dying a horrible death. I just think its an extremely clever game and can be played in so many different ways. If you just wanna go in and play it as a regular shooter you can do that. Jump on the soldier or scout class and go blast some fools. If you wanna use strategy and stealth then go master the spy. You could go about in enemy territory killing people without them realising you are even there if played correctly. About the maps. They are going with that visual theme at the moment but I hear that there is plans to bring in an entirely new look with additional maps down the line. All the other classes are going to receive similar updates to what the medic just gained as well. Sorry for the essay. --- |

2008-04-21 00:17:46 Well, I don't quite understand what you mean by having to shoot someone a "million" times. That all depends on what weapon you are using. For instance I can take a player out with 3 well placed rockets. The game's basic gameplay owes its heritage to stuff like Quake, while being vastly different in that it has layers of gameplay to learn before it all really clicks. The best suggestion I have is to start with an easy to play class, watch the levels intro movie, and work with your teammates. I don't play it very often but I do think it's a fun game. |
